The applicable rules of exponents are ...
(a^b)(a^c) = a^(b+c)
a = a^1
(a^b)/(a^c) = a^(b-c)
a^0 = 1 . . . . for any 'a' not 0
__
The given expression is ...
(11^8)/(11^3) = 11^(8-3) = 11^5
The offered choices are ...
(11^7)/(11^7) = 11^(7-7) = 11^0 = 1
11·11^4 = (11^1)(11^4) = 11^(1+4) = 11^5 . . . . matches the given expression
(11^0)/(11^5) = 11^(0-5) = 11^-5
11^0 = 1
